Description

An in depth discussion of the most effective ways to gather and record evidence, the admissibility of evidence and potential risks.

Topics include:

  • Investigation techniques;
  • Interviewing offenders;
  • Admissibility of documents and photographs;
  • Giving of formal notices; and
  • Powers of entry.

Presenter:

Peter is one of Perth's leading local government lawyers. He has particular expertise in local government law enforcement and has carried out numerous prosecutions for local governments under the full range of legislation administered and enforced by local governments. Peter has appeared as Counsel in the Magistrates Court, State Administrative Tribunal and the Supreme Court. Many of the Supreme Court appeals against sentences conducted by Peter have since become the leading cases in relation to sentencing for local government offences in WA. Peter frequently prepares papers and presents seminars to local government in relation to the enforcement of local government legislation and the processes necessary to make local government law enforcement more efficient and effective.
